In each section, I'll use engaging lecture and vivid PowerPoint presentations to introduce learners to the basic periods of Western Art History. Throughout the class, we will discover what historical events influenced the style of the periods and meet the various artists who represent them. We will look at examples of the artists' works and styles, so that learners will be able identify artists by their paintings or sculptures. Although students will not be asked to fully draw or reproduce any of the works, I will use a document camera to help students complete a printable worksheet to practice or examine some of the visual elements used in art pieces, such as line, shape, and color. These activities will help students appreciate the technique and style used by these artists. Whether or not the learner has ever studied art, I want this class to be fun and engaging. No previous art experience is necessary for learners to enjoy this class.
